Raxaul is a sub-divisional town in the East Champaran district of the Indian state of Bihar. It is situated on the India-Nepal border opposite Birgunj (Nepal), and is an entry point in Nepal by road and rail. The Indian border town of Raxaul has become one of the busiest towns for heavy transportation due to high trade volume. Falejarganj is one of the oldest known name of Raxaul.
